  2. Robert J. Sampson is a leading criminologist and urban planner who studies crime, disorder, the life course, neighborhood effects, and the social structure of the city. He is the author of three award-winning books and a founding director of the Boston Area Research Initiative, and a member of the National Academy of Sciences and other esteemed academies.

  3. Robert LeRoy Sampson [1] (May 10, 1933 – January 18, 2020) was an American actor. He was known for playing the role of Father Mike Fitzgerald in the American sitcom television series Bridget Loves Bernie. [2] Life and career. Sampson was born in Los Angeles, California, the son of Roy Sampson.

  4. Robert J. Sampson (born July 9, 1956, in Utica, New York) is the Woodford L. and Ann A. Flowers University Professor at Harvard University and Director of the Social Sciences Program at the Radcliffe Institute for Advanced Study. From 2005 through 2010, Sampson served as the Chair of the Department of Sociology at Harvard.

  5. Robert Sampson was born on 10 May 1933 in Los Angeles, California, USA. He was an actor, known for Re-Animator (1985), The Dark Side of the Moon (1990) and Robot Jox (1989). He was married to Maryanne Gackle. He died on 18 January 2020 in Santa Barbara, California, USA.
